Understanding Drive Cloning
Drive cloning involves copying the entire contents of one storage device to another. Unlike simple file transfers, cloning creates a bit-for-bit copy, which includes the file system and all hidden files. This is particularly beneficial when upgrading to a larger drive or moving from HDD to SSD since it preserves the structure and functionality of your system.
Before You Start
Before you begin the cloning process, there are a few important steps to take:
- Backup Important Data: Always backup your data before cloning. This ensures you have a secondary copy in case something goes wrong.
- Check Drive Compatibility: Ensure that the new drive is compatible with your system and has enough capacity to hold all the data from the original drive.
- Gather Cloning Software: Use reliable cloning software for the best results. Some popular options include Clonezilla, Macrium Reflect, and EaseUS Todo Backup.
Step-by-Step Guide to Clone Hard Drives and SSDs
Step 1: Connect the Destination Drive
Plug in your new hard drive or SSD to your computer, either internally or via a USB-to-SATA adapter for external connections. Make sure the drive is detected by the operating system.
Step 2: Install Cloning Software
Download and install your chosen cloning software. Each software will have a slightly different setup process, but generally, you’ll want to look for an option to create a clone or disk image.
Step 3: Select Source and Destination Drives
Once the software is open, choose the original drive (source) that you want to clone and the new drive (destination) where you wish to transfer the data. Carefully verify that you have selected the correct drives to avoid any data loss.
Step 4: Start the Cloning Process
Initiate the cloning process. This may take some time depending on the size of the data and the speed of the drives involved. Most software will provide you with a progress indicator.
Step 5: Verify the Clone
After the cloning is complete, it’s crucial to verify that the data has been transferred correctly. You can do this by booting from the new drive or checking that files appear intact.
Cloning SSDs vs. HDDs
While the cloning process is similar for both SSDs and HDDs, there are some nuances to be aware of:
- TRIM Support: When cloning SSDs, ensure that the software supports TRIM, which helps maintain the performance of the SSD by freeing up unused space while cloning.
- Sector Sizes: Confirm that the sector sizes of your old and new drives match, especially if you are switching between SATA and NVMe drives.
Common Cloning Issues
While cloning drives is straightforward, some common issues may arise:
- Drive Not Detected: Ensure connections are secure and that the drive is initialized and formatted correctly.
- Insufficient Space: If the destination drive does not have enough space, consider cleaning up unnecessary files on the source drive before cloning.
- Clone Fails or Is Corrupted: Use reliable cloning software and double-check your settings to minimize errors.
